The festival draws thousands of visitors from across the GCC and the broader Middle East region each year. Since its launch 19 years ago, the organizing committee has continuously incorporated new ideas and activities each year, while maintaining the values associated with the holy month of Ramadan and Eid Al Fitr. Shopping and promotional activities are launched across the emirate, accompanied by many social, economic, educational, religious, sporting, medical and environmental initiatives, as well as entertainment and promotional activities that attract people from all walks of life throughout the 40-day period.
